Following on from hhrangers thread about which players we would like to see play for us next season made me think about which teams will be having a clearout as soon as the season ends. The one obvious team is Manchester City. If January was anything to go but it will be a busy summer at Eastlands with many new arrivals which means there will also be many departures.
So who will definitely be leaving? Who won't be leaving but could be tempted for a loan move and who could we possibly buy?
Manchester City Players Leaving on a Bosman:
Defenders: Michael Ball, Shaleum Logan, Danny Mills & Gláuber
Midfielders: Kelvin Etuhu & Dietmar Hamann
Forwards: Darius Vassell
NOTE: Daniel Sturridge is also available on a Bosman put contract talks are supposedly on going. If he were to leave he will no doubt stay in the Premiership.
My View of the Bosmans:
Logan is a product of the Man City academy but has very little first team experience so would be a risk. Mills is still recovering from a long term injury and is now considered "injury-prone". Glauber is a centre back with plenty of experience but this isn't a position we need strengthening. Of all the defenders Ball is the stand out player. We need a left back and he has always been a very good player - I think he would excel at this level.
Etuhu is a right winger, which is a position we are strong in so not required. Hamann may have lost some speed but at this level he could be exactly what we need - a better version of both Mahon and Leigertwood. As for Vassell, well unfortunately he never lived up to expectation. He wouldn't be a starter for us but would be a very useful squad player.
Manchester City Players who won't get much first team action:
GK's: Kasper Schmeichel & Joe Hart
Midfielders: Gelson Fernandes & Michael Johnson
Forwards: Benjani, Ched Evans & Valeri Bojinov
My View of those who won't get much first team action:
Hart is likely to be Given's number two and even if he was loaned out the deal would probably feature a 24 hour recall - not really what we want. Schmeichel could be an option but if we are to sign a keeper this summer it has to be someone who in the long term takes over from Cerny and isn't just at the club waiting to be recalled. Johnson would only be available on loan but would be a very good signing if we could do that. Fernandes isn't required. Evans is now 6th or 7th choice striker at City so although I don't think he will be sold I do think he'll go out on loan. Bojinov won't get much action but I don't expect him to turn up at HQ anytime soon. I'm unsure of Benjani. Man City no longer need him but is he too good for the Championship?
